About Token 
Ransomware and Phishing attacks are the largest threats facing every organization today. Token has invented Next-Generation MFA that stops these attacks, and it is changing the way our customers secure their organizations. The Token Ring provides wearable, biometric, multifactor authentication. We deliver the next generation of access security that is invulnerable to social engineering, malware, and removes the shortcomings of legacy MFA for organizations where breaches, data loss, and ransomware must be prevented.

What You Offer  
The Amazon Web Services (AWS) Cloud Services Engineer is responsible for designing, developing, and maintaining cloud-based applications, infrastructure and platforms. They are responsible for ensuring the reliability, scalability, and security of our cloud systems. 

Responsibilities:

  • Architect, design, and deploy scalable, reliable, and secure cloud infrastructure on AWS.
  • Write, test, and debug code adhering to best practices and coding standards.
  • Manage, monitor, and optimize cloud resources, ensuring high availability and performance.
  • Develop and implement automation scripts using tools like AWS CloudFormation, Terraform, or similar to streamline operations.
  • Implement and maintain cloud security best practices, including identity and access management (IAM), encryption, and network security.
  • Monitor and manage cloud costs, optimizing resources to ensure cost-effective use of AWS services.
  • Diagnose and resolve technical issues related to cloud infrastructure and services.
  • Collaborate with cross-functional teams to define, design, and ship new features and improve existing ones.
  • Work closely with development teams to ensure smooth deployment and integration of applications in the cloud environment.
  • Create and maintain detailed documentation of cloud architecture, configurations, and processes.
  • Stay up to date with the latest AWS services, features, and best practices to continually enhance our cloud infrastructure.
